Nuclear magnetic resonance (NMR) studies of the c subunit of F1F(o) ATP synthase from Escherichia coli are presented. A combination of homonuclear (H-1-H-1) and heteronuclear (H-1-N-15) 2D and 3D methods was applied to the 79-residue protein, dissolved in trifluoroethanol. Resonance assignment for all the backbone amide groups and many C(alpha)H side-chain protons was achieved. Analysis of inter- and intraresidue H-1-H-1 nuclear Overhauser effect (NOE) data and scalar coupling constant information indicates that this protein contains two extended regions of predominant alpha-helical character (residues 10-40 and 48-77) separated by an eight-residue segment which displays little evidence of ordered secondary structure. This model is consistent with information about the molecular motion of the protein deduced from N-15-H-1 heteronuclear NOE data and observed pK(a) values of carboxylic acid groups.
